1a) angle x and angle y are corresponding angles. Both angles lie on the same side of the transversal. Since the lines are parallel, the angles are equal.
1b) angle x and angle y are interior angles on the same side of the transversal. Since the lines are parallel, the angles are equal supplementary.
1c) angle x and angle y are corresponding angles. Both angles lie on the same side of the transversal. Since the lines are parallel, the angles are equal.
1d) angle x and angle y are alternate interior angles. They are between the parallel lines and alternate sides of the transversal. Since the lines are parallel, the angles are equal.

We have been given an equation y+6=45(x+3) in point slope form.
It says to use the point and slope from given equation to create the graph.
So compare equation y+6=45(x+3) with point slope formula
y-y1=m(x-x1)
we see that m=45, x1=-3 and y1=-6
Hence first point is at (-3,-6)
slope m=45 is positive so to find another point, previous point will move 45 units up then 1 unit right and reach at the location (-2,39).
Now we just graph both points (-3,-6) and (-2,39) and join them by a straight line. Final graph will look like the attached graph.
